Output d68092034abe5a9ed8b55feaa5012c7251caa6dc63a1d77ee92c4478a3911e9a:3

value
66638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8029eaca32bd329f2746455903e4d7222489edea OP_EQUAL
address
3DNgdYzywkTreakwzSgkBb7kGgn25jo2zm
transaction
d68092034abe5a9ed8b55feaa5012c7251caa6dc63a1d77ee92c4478a3911e9a
spent
true